Output 954a7656f84150c6295c3a401e37cd29dda701dac9107623c88fdbd626dafcf5:1

value
1160843633
script pubkey
OP_0 OP_PUSHBYTES_20 fa471029ecbe4c4b4482e2b227ff7ed305999abe
address
bc1qlfr3q20vhexyk3yzu2ez0lm76vzenx47twkaxm
transaction
954a7656f84150c6295c3a401e37cd29dda701dac9107623c88fdbd626dafcf5
confirmations
352361
spent
true